    For what it's worth, the eBay listing says only 72 were made (for each night, I'm assuming). I'm not sure how accurate that really is.
    One merch booth said they had 60 each night. One merch booth told me EACH BOOTH got 60 each night, which I'm guessing is right since only lower booths had them. THat would have made about 300 per night, which sounds right to me since I saw a lot of people wearing them at the show plus a few have popped up here as well.

    which piece of merch are we talking about here?

    I believe they are referring to the August 23rd Cubs logo/Pearl Jam t-shirt, it was a very limited edition, I got in at 7pm and I didn't see it, didn't see anyone wearing it either, I found out about it the next day on the board.
